## **Why the Diawl Bachs Nymph?**
The Diawl Bachs (Welsh for “Little Devil”) is a classic nymph pattern designed to mimic midge pupae, small mayfly nymphs, and other aquatic invertebrates. Its slim profile and natural movement in the water make it irresistible to trout, especially in stillwaters and slow-moving rivers. ## **Choosing the Right Size & Colour**
One of the biggest advantages of the **Diawl Bachs Nymph** is its availability in various sizes and colours. Here’s how to select the best option for your fishing conditions:
### **1. Selecting the Right Size**
– **Size 12-14**: Ideal for imitating larger mayfly nymphs in rivers and lakes.
– **Size 16-18**: Perfect for midge pupae and smaller insects, especially in clear water.
– **Size 10 (3x Heavy)**: Best for deep, fast-flowing water or when targeting big trout.
### **2. Choosing the Best Colour**
Trout can be selective, so matching the natural insects in your fishery is crucial.
– **Olive**: A great all-rounder, mimicking olive nymphs and damselfly larvae.
– **Black**: Excellent for midge pupae and darker mayfly nymphs.
– **Red**: Triggers aggressive strikes, especially in stained water.
– **Pearl/Silver**: Works well in bright conditions, imitating emerging insects.
## **How to Fish the Diawl Bachs Nymph**
To maximize success with this fly, consider these techniques:
### **1. Suspender Rig (Bung Fishing)**
– Use a floating indicator (bung) to suspend the nymph at the desired depth.
– Adjust leader length based on water depth (typically 1.5x the depth).
### **2. Washing Line Method**
– Fish the Diawl Bachs under a dry fly or buoyant fly to create a two-fly setup.
– Works well in stillwaters where trout feed near the surface.
### **3. Euro Nymphing (for Rivers)**
– Use a long leader and weighted nymph setup for a natural drift.
– The slim profile of the Diawl Bachs makes it perfect for this technique.
